My ultimate comfort food is bricklayer’s eggs (huevos al albanil) from Diane Kennedy. Toasted pasilla and guajillo chilies are steeped in boiling water and pureed with garlic and white onion (I used shallots). Fry the chile paste until dry, and then lower the heat and mix in the eggs. Serve on flame-warmed flour tortillas topped with feta cheese and Mexican oregano.

Huevos al albanil (Bricklayer's eggs)
